Given our local rural roads and seasonal temperature swings, common issues include suspension components from potholes, battery problems due to extreme heat and cold, and increased brake wear from driving on hilly, gravel roads. Toyota models like the Camry and Corolla also frequently need attention for oil consumption and serpentine belt replacements.

Seek service promptly if the light is flashing, which indicates a severe misfire, or if you notice any performance issues like loss of power. For a steady light, you can visit an auto parts store for a free code scan, but a local repair shop with proper Toyota diagnostic tools is needed for an accurate diagnosis and repair, especially before longer drives on Highway 61.
Yes, our region's conditions necessitate more frequent checks. Dust and gravel from rural roads mean air and cabin filters should be changed more often. The humidity and use of road salt in winter also make undercarriage inspections for rust crucial. Consider more frequent brake inspections and tire rotations due to our hilly terrain and variable road surfaces.
